   A soft-switched dual active bridge 3DC-to-1DC converter employed in a high-voltage electronic power transformer   [View] 
 [Download] 
 Author(s)   H. Wrede; V. Staudt; A. Steimel 
 Abstract   The analysis of a soft-switched dual active bridge 3DC-to-1DC converter, employed in a cascaded-converter-based high-voltage electronic power transformer is presented. The the design of a single-phase transformer, its kVA rating and utilization are derived, due to a phase shift and zero-voltage switching conditions. In the transformer utilization-vs-kVA-rating plane an optimal transformer design point can be found and the design of a single-phase cable-wound transformer with a rated power of 1.66 MW and 1 kHz operating frequency for a 3x16,6kV-DC-to-1x9.6kV-DC conversion is presented.
